WHEREAS, the Civil Service Board, on March 3, 1977, unanimously recommended the approval of employment past the age of 72-1/2 for JUAN PERE2, CUSTODIAN FOREMAN, bEPARTMENT OF PUBLIC FACILITIES; and WHEREAS, the City Physician has determined that the physical condition of said JUAN PEREZ is satisfactory for continued employment; N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E COMMISSION OF THE CITY OF MIAMI, FLORIDA: Section 1. A one (1) year extension of employment past the age of 72-1/2 is hereby granted for JUAN PEREZ, CUSTODAIN FOREMAN, DEPARTMENT OF PUBLIC FACILITIES, effective March 8, 1977 through March 7, 1978, with the provision that in the event of a rollback or layoff, MR. Jennings, Director Department of Public Facilities February 24, 1977 Juan Perez Request for continuation of Active Service beyond age 72 Mr. Juan Perez; who is classified as Custodian Foreman with this department, has requested continuation of active service beyond his 72nd birthday, March 8, 1977. In accordance with Rule II, Section 4 of the Civil Service Rules and Regulations of the City of Miami, Florida, it is hereby recommended that Mr. Perez be retained on active service. Mr. Perez is utilized In a supervisory capacity: and replacement of a person with his dedication, years of experience, ability to handle subordinates, bilingual ability, and energy would be extremely difficult. This department is most desirous of retaining his services.
